West Dover Hundred

Inscription. Originally part of St. Jones Hundred, renamed Dover Hundred 1823, the boundaries being Little Creek on the north and St. Jones Creek on the south, extending from Delaware River to Maryland Line. Dover Hundred was divided 1877 into two hundreds, called West Dover Hundred, and East Dover Hundred.
 
Erected 1932 by Historic Markers Comission.
